Output 32ecade3ca6486bb37846f31b362bf9f15ece1c7408ec6cfba4a51431a8da2ea:20

value
87805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40fb324ec56a757e48876e037e636f29bda931ac OP_EQUAL
address
37cc6G5GArcxQeWixJ7UPY2ijdSNHTx9tc
transaction
32ecade3ca6486bb37846f31b362bf9f15ece1c7408ec6cfba4a51431a8da2ea
confirmations
177193
spent
true